About Your Role

The Construction Manager oversees the planning, execution, and completion of construction, renovation, and capital improvement projects within occupied and operational facilities. This role manages contractors, schedules, budgets, project documentation, quality, and safety while minimizing disruption to ongoing operations. The Construction Manager coordinates closely with internal stakeholders, design teams, consultants, vendors, government agencies, and contractors to maintain facility standards, regulatory compliance, and quality throughout all phases of construction.

What You’ll Do

  • Oversee construction of new facilities and renovation of existing facilities to ensure compliance with applicable governmental codes, specifications, project requirements, and client expectations.
  • Ensure permits, bonds, approvals, lien waivers, and project closeout documentation are properly secured and completed.
  • Provide oversight throughout all phases of construction, from project planning and groundbreaking through final completion and occupancy approval.
  • Monitor project quality, budget, schedule, safety, and compliance through regular site visits, inspections, and contractor coordination.
  • Identify and communicate cost-saving opportunities, value-engineering opportunities, and process improvements.
  • Assist with the review of engineering, building, architectural, and site design documents prepared by architects and engineering firms.
  • Coordinate with clients, leadership, design teams, consultants, contractors, government agencies, utility providers, suppliers, and other project stakeholders to maintain project schedules and resolve issues.
  • Advise leadership regarding project status, operational improvements, risks, challenges, and team effectiveness.
  • Communicate recurring project issues, resource requirements, and training needs to management.
  • Assist with site evaluations and development of building and construction cost estimates.
  • Review proposed change orders for accuracy, cost validation, scope alignment, and supporting documentation.
  • Review contractor payment applications and verify collection of required lien waivers and supporting documentation.
  • Verify completion of corrective actions identified through commissioning reports, inspections, punch lists, and quality reviews.
  • Assist with mentoring, training, and professional development of team members.
  • Maintain confidentiality and security of project documents and company information.
  • Perform additional duties as assigned.
